By failing to prepare, you are preparing to fail. ~ Benjamin Franklin


Morning Reflections: Laying the Groundwork
🧠🌅

A space to honor the quiet power of readiness before action.

  1. “What would it mean to begin today with deliberate intention?”
    — Consider how preparation shapes your mindset and momentum.
  2. “Where am I tempted to ‘wing it’—and what’s the cost?”
    — Notice the areas where neglecting foresight leads to friction.
  3. “What one thing can I prepare now to ease the path ahead?”
    — Choose a small act of readiness that builds confidence.

Guiding Thought: Preparation is not perfection—it’s a quiet promise to your future self.


Midday Reflections: Rechecking the Compass
🧭📋

A moment to pause and assess: are you aligned with what you set out to do?

  1. “Have I drifted from my morning intentions—and why?”
    — Gently trace the shift without judgment.
  2. “What unexpected challenges have tested my preparedness?”
    — Reflect on how you responded and what you learned.
  3. “What can I adjust now to finish the day with clarity?”
    — Recalibrate with purpose, not pressure.

Guiding Thought: Midday is a checkpoint, not a verdict. Realignment is a form of wisdom.


Evening Reflections: Honoring the Effort
🕯️📖

A space to reflect on what preparation made possible—and what it revealed.

  1. “What did I handle well today because I was prepared?”
    — Celebrate the quiet victories of foresight.
  2. “Where did lack of preparation create stress or missed opportunity?”
    — Name it not to judge, but to learn.
  3. “How can I use today’s lessons to prepare more wisely tomorrow?”
    — Let reflection become your blueprint.

Guiding Thought: Every day teaches you how to prepare better. Listen closely—your future is speaking.
